Oxygen evolving complex oxygen
The oxygen evolving complex is a water oxidizing enzyme involved in the photooxidation of water during the light reactions of photosynthesis. Based on a widely accepted theory from 1970 by Kok, the complex can exist in 5 states: S0 to S4. Photons trapped by photosystem II move the system from state S0 to S4. S4 is unstable and reacts with water to produce oxygen. Currently the functional mechanism of the complex is not completely understood. Much of the known data have been collected from flash experiments, EPR, and X-ray spectroscopy.
